From 3fa3db32956d74c0784171ae0334685502bb169a Mon Sep 17 00:00:00 2001 From: Christophe Leroy Date: Fri, 12 Mar 2021 13:25:11 +0000 Subject: powerpc/align: Convert emulate_spe() to user_access_begin This patch converts emulate_spe() to using user_access_begin logic. Since commit 662bbcb2747c ("mm, sched: Allow uaccess in atomic with pagefault_disable()"), might_fault() doesn't fire when called from sections where pagefaults are disabled, which must be the case when using _inatomic variants of __get_user and __put_user. So the might_fault() in user_access_begin() is not a problem. There was a verification of user_mode() together with the access_ok(), but there is a second verification of user_mode() just after, that leads to immediate return. The access_ok() is now part of the user_access_begin which is called after that other user_mode() verification, so no need to check user_mode() again. Nowadays, get_user() is granting userspace access and is exclusively for userspace access. In alignment exception handler, use probe_kernel_read_inst() instead of __get_user_instr() for reading instructions in kernel. This will allow to remove the is_kernel_addr() check in __get/put_user() in a following patch.
